For my surgeon, he asked that I go on a full liquid diet for 2 weeks prior to surgery. The rule was: If it's thicker than whole milk, you can't have it. I am on day 6 of my liquid diet (I am being banded on 5/16!!!). They want me to have at least 60g of Protein each day, and said that I needed to find a Protein Shake that has at least 20g of Protein and less than 9g of Sugar. I went to GNC and found a pre-made shake called "GNC Total Lean". It has 25g of Protein and only 2g of sugar! I love chocolate, so I got the chocolate one. It pretty much tastes like chocolate milk. I have found that I am only able to drink about 1/2 of one at a time, and then I am full. I will save the other half for later in the day.

I am also allowed to eat Soups (very very thin soups). I have been buying Campbells Soup at Hand. They are pretty good, and 1 container is more than enough to hold me. They also suggested cream of ____ Soups, thinned with milk (Cream of chicken, mushroom, etc... 1 can plus 1 cup of milk makes it the perfect consistency... I sometimes add garlic or something to make it tastier). I have been really sticking to drinking my Water (which I am SOOO not usually a fan of). My fiance actually found a Water flavoring thing that I have fallen in love with! It's called MIO, and is in the same section as Crystal Light and such (in my store, anyway). I doesn't have any calories, sugar or anything. I love it! I will post a link with both the MIO and the GNC shake at the end. I have not been hungry at all. Now, don't get me wrong, if someone were to sit in front of me with a cheeseburger, I might just steal it from them... but it's more because I know I can have it than because I am hungry.

One thing that I have noticed is that... I want something to CHEW. So to keep myself from cheating, I have starting keeping a cup of ice chips... idk, probably a mental thing, but not having anything to crunch on for a week is hard! I have lost 8 pounds since Tuesday, and the amount of energy I have is UNBELIEVABLE! It's amazing how changing what you put IN your body can do!
